The American Petroleum Institute (API) published the , titled Centrifugal Pumps for Petroleum, Petrochemical, and Natural Gas Industries . This edition supersedes the 12th Edition (2010) and represents the latest evolution in pump technology, reliability engineering, and standardization. The tighter mechanical requirements (deflection, balancing, bearing seals) directly address the most common failure modes in centrifugal pumps. While initial costs will rise, the total cost of ownership is expected to decrease by 15–20% over 10 years due to reduced maintenance and downtime.
